On-Site Content Reviewer / Customer SupportLocations: Greece (project-dependent)Contract: Fixed-term (6–12 months)Relocation: Available for selected projectsCommon Requirements
Native or fluent language skillsGood English for internal communicationEU citizenship or valid EU work eligibilityAttention to detail & guideline-based decision makingComfortable with repetitive tasks
ItalianLocation: GreeceSalary: €1,200 – €1,500 / monthExtras: Accommodation support / relocation assistance#J-18808-Ljbffr